Colombia routes consumer traffic mainly through ISPs such as Claro, Movistar (Telefónica), and Tigo (Millicom), with mobile coverage from carriers like Claro, Movistar, and Tigo. Prices are quoted in COP ($) and most public pages localise content by spanish language and region. Bogotá is a fast-growing data-center hub, while multiple submarine cables land on the Caribbean coast at Cartagena and Barranquilla; Colombia enforces data protection under Ley 1581 of 2012.
